History & Origin

Shivam comes from Sanskrit shivam, 'auspicious, pure, blessed, good, benign' β€” and 'of Shiva', the great Hindu god of transformation and renewal. A name of blessing and devotion, it is widely popular across modern India.

In the U.S. it appears in Indian families. Rare, auspicious at the root, and divine.

Did you know? 'Satyam Shivam Sundaram' β€” 'the true, the auspicious, the beautiful' β€” is a famous Sanskrit phrase for the divine; Shivam is the 'auspicious' at its heart.

Frequently Asked

What does the name Shivam mean?

Shivam is Sanskrit for 'auspicious, pure, blessed, good', also 'of Shiva'.

How do you pronounce Shivam?

It's said shih-VAHM /ΚƒΙͺˈvΙ‘m/ β€” two syllables, stress on the second.

Is Shivam a boy or girl name?

Shivam is a boy's name.

How popular is Shivam?

Shivam is a rare name in the U.S. and popular in India.
